Output 21effb1083c750e766dc9e32ccc9dee3dac6ccb25631c91375b43dfa6839ee3a:0

value
2996719
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ce78833e4607f612929e417baa041bf4e89d091f OP_EQUAL
address
3LWjVRmZLtm1GEX9w2BkMY3ZkyCdpvrxYT
transaction
21effb1083c750e766dc9e32ccc9dee3dac6ccb25631c91375b43dfa6839ee3a
spent
true